Introduction: IPTV (Internet Protocol television) is a popular digital TV service that uses the internet to deliver TV programming. One of the key features of IPTV is the ability to provide multiple connections, allowing multiple users to watch different channels simultaneously. This has made it an attractive option for special needs communities, who require tailored programming and the ability to customize their viewing experience. In this blog, we will explore the benefits of multiple connections in IPTV for special needs communities.

Customizable Viewing Experience: IPTV allows for a highly customizable viewing experience, with users able to choose from a range of channels and programming options. This is particularly beneficial for special needs communities, who may require tailored programming to meet their specific needs. For example, IPTV can provide access to sign language interpreters or audio descriptions, ensuring that programming is accessible for individuals with visual or hearing impairments. Additionally, IPTV can provide access to a range of programming in different languages, which is beneficial for non-native speakers or individuals with language difficulties.

Multiple Connections for Caregivers and Family Members: Another benefit of multiple connections in IPTV is that it allows caregivers and family members to watch programming with special needs individuals. This is particularly beneficial for children or individuals with developmental disabilities, who may require additional support or supervision while watching TV. With multiple connections, caregivers can monitor and engage with the programming, ensuring that the viewing experience is safe and enjoyable for everyone.

Cost-Effective: IPTV is often a more cost-effective option than traditional cable or satellite TV, as it eliminates the need for expensive equipment and infrastructure. This can be especially beneficial for special needs communities, who may have additional medical or educational expenses to consider. Additionally, IPTV providers often offer flexible payment options and subscription plans, allowing users to choose a package that meets their specific needs and budget.

Improved Accessibility: Multiple connections in IPTV also improve accessibility, as they allow users to watch programming on a range of devices, including computers, tablets, and smartphones. This is particularly beneficial for individuals with mobility issues or who may be confined to a specific location, such as a hospital or care facility. With IPTV, users can access programming from anywhere with an internet connection, providing greater flexibility and independence.
